Aims: The aim of this research was to analyze the spatial structure of the worn-out fabric of Shahrood city using the space layout approach.
Methodology: This mixed research was conducted in the spring and summer of 2022 by the method of combined analysis of space layout in Shahrood city. "Axis lines" analysis was chosen as the appropriate research method. Each of the elements of the spatial arrangement, including macro and local connection, average depth, control and the number of connections of Shahrood city were calculated. The analysis of the findings was presented graphically and the calculation of spatial indices using the Depth Map Cityengine software, 2015.
Findings: The average correlation in the radius n or comprehensive correlation of Shahrood city was 0.22±1.14 (maximum 1.73 and minimum 0.35). The average connection of Shahrood city was 1.34±6.72 (maximum 10 and minimum 1). The average depth of Shahrood city was 3.66±0.23 (maximum 4.23 and minimum 1.5). The average trust index, which is an important factor in creating movement in the city and the points of origin and destination, was 0.025±0.133 (maximum 1.4 and minimum 0.001).
Conclusion: The spatial structure of the worn-out fabric of Shahrood, by absorbing a high degree of interconnection, connection and selection from other spaces of the city, plays an essential role in the spatial configuration of the city, and the distribution and development of the main axes should be transferred from the center to the periphery
